#5815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5815ce is composed of 34.5% red, 8.2%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 261.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 44.5%. #5815ce color hex could be obtained by blending #b02aff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#5815ce color description : Strong violet.
#5815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5815ce has RGB values of R:88, G:21,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 5772750.

Shades and Tints of #5815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010a is the darkest color, while #faf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5815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706c77 is the less saturated color, while #5304df is the most saturated one.
